Kate Mazzara is a licensed Professional Engineer with over 30 years of experience in civil/transportation engineering, specifically the design and project management of highway projects for the State of Maryland and Prince George’s County. She is currently the Associate Director of the Office of Engineering and Project Management for Prince George’s County Department of Public Works and Transportation. In this role, Ms. Mazzara is responsible for overseeing the implementation of the county’s road and bridge Capital Improvement Program, management of the bridge inspection program, traffic analysis and design, pedestrian safety program, green complete street program, the acquisition and management of real properties, and construction activities as related to the county’s infrastructure. Previously, Ms. Mazzara was with the Maryland State Highway Administration for 20 years, serving in a number of positions responsible for the design and project management of a multitude of complex and major projects throughout the state. She also oversaw the system preservation program, including resurfacing, intersection improvements, and pedestrian improvements, for state roads in Montgomery and Prince George’s County. In this role, she often served as a liaison between the Administration and local officials. Ms. Mazzara graduated with a BS in Civil Engineering from the University of Maryland, College Park. She has been a licensed Professional Engineer since 2000.
